Output cf39eb62c65f142bb01bf03e36d870bbd4c8f37b985c83d28beb614b79edcea9:0

value
23479091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0912d2c36ed40651eda6bb43a43f4be3c640bfa OP_EQUAL
address
3Pd21cv6dBSdQ4npbKU2GC85dU4Tb6K6PP
transaction
cf39eb62c65f142bb01bf03e36d870bbd4c8f37b985c83d28beb614b79edcea9
spent
true